> On Mon, 20 Oct 2014, Andrei POPESCU wrote:
>
> >At what stage? The postinst script of a package is only executed at
> >installation time. What you did in the meantime...
>
> I did: apt-get --reinstall install samba-common
>
> So, it seems that with --reinstall, the postinst script is not
> executed, which is not what I would expect.
You might have better success with
dpkg-reconfigure samba-common
instead.
> I saw:
>
> You can reinstall a package with sudo apt-get install --reinstall
> packagename. This completely removes the package (but not its
> dependencies), and then re-install the package.
That doesn't appear to be from the apt-get manual and seems wrong to me.
